1 #========================================================================
3 # FoFi library Makefile
5 # Copyright 2003 Glyph & Cog, LLC
7 #========================================================================
14 GOOSRCDIR = $(srcdir)/../goo
17 CXXFLAGS = @CXXFLAGS@ @DEFS@ -I.. -I$(GOOSRCDIR) -I$(srcdir)
23 LIBPREFIX = @LIBPREFIX@
25 #------------------------------------------------------------------------
30 $(CXX) $(CXXFLAGS) -c $<
32 #------------------------------------------------------------------------
35 $(srcdir)/FoFiBase.cc \
36 $(srcdir)/FoFiEncodings.cc \
37 $(srcdir)/FoFiTrueType.cc \
38 $(srcdir)/FoFiType1.cc \
39 $(srcdir)/FoFiType1C.cc
41 #------------------------------------------------------------------------
43 all: $(LIBPREFIX)fofi.a
45 #------------------------------------------------------------------------
54 $(LIBPREFIX)fofi.a: $(FOFI_OBJS)
55 rm -f $(LIBPREFIX)fofi.a
56 $(AR) $(LIBPREFIX)fofi.a $(FOFI_OBJS)
57 $(RANLIB) $(LIBPREFIX)fofi.a
59 #------------------------------------------------------------------------
62 rm -f $(FOFI_OBJS) $(LIBPREFIX)fofi.a
64 #------------------------------------------------------------------------
67 $(CXX) $(CXXFLAGS) -MM $(CXX_SRC) >Makefile.dep